REGENTS OF THE UNIV. OF CALIFORNIA v. SHEILY, B161797
In a condemnation proceeding, plaintiff's claim for compensation for goodwill is denied where he failed to prove by a preponderance of the evidence that he was entitled to compensation under the requisites of Code of Civil Procedure section 1263.510.
